Never show Battery OK

The battery available power is not only dependent on temperature and current voltage ( which is already incorporated).
Sometimes batteries “crash” from , what is considered OK, to unusable on a short time.

It’s OK to warn user that, based on current conditions, the battery should be replaced as that is prudent. But really It depends on the critically of the application and the ease of replacement. For example if monitoring the temperature of the basement( just because it’s nice to know when it’s cold ) with a ruuvi on top of a bookcase (easily accessible) many users would wait until the battery is completely depleted before replacement.

Telling the user that the battery is OK gives a false sense of security.
